Overview

The Safety Manager will be in charge of evaluating all safety protocols followed at all 8 of Metalcraft’s facilities, organize safety training for employees, reports problems to management, and train and grow the current safety team and program.

Responsibilities

  • Manage and oversee current safety staff of 4.
  • Visit all Metalcraft locations and conduct safety audits and verify equipment and materials are up to standards
  • Conducts safety meetings, audits, and inspections to ensure compliance, evaluate performance, identify corrective action, and implement corrective actions.
  • Monitor compliance to policies and laws by inspecting employees and operations
  • Work with safety team, executive team, and managers to inspect equipment and machinery to observe possible unsafe conditions
  • Research and implement new materials handling processes
  • Analyze accident reports and evaluate injury case studies based on available facts
  • Prepare and conduct training sessions for all employees and vendors
  • Preparing and enforcing policies to continue to establish a culture of health and safety
  • Ensure compliance with all regulatory bodies and standards (OSHA, EPA, etc.)
  • Research environmental regulations and policies and institute changes to ensure compliance
  • Track, record, and monitor incident metrics and apply findings
  • Oversee the applications for and receipt of necessary permits
  • Oversee work comp cases through all of our facilities
  • Other duties as assigned.
